Transaction 96e8600202119fe25768ae6d6fcd60645804035e5a6b657a2081fe19b15bde31
1 Input
1 Output
-
96e8600202119fe25768ae6d6fcd60645804035e5a6b657a2081fe19b15bde31:0
- value
- 498109812
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b587977bea64c280cd3188f32dacc895ccbd228 OP_EQUAL
- address
- 3CwD2TGk6Uv2PmuR9DYmSHQJsnrotwAhb5